Output b85e9cd83d56b4ec68452d26adb73b2262c95d9ecff41ac1009d31eb0045b8b8:69

value
66231227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5911d5b3b7ac9d22c6c81c6879ba8ebbedfcbc OP_EQUAL
address
MU5YGVayTZTW3iLcaGRGcphv5p29bqfKyD
transaction
b85e9cd83d56b4ec68452d26adb73b2262c95d9ecff41ac1009d31eb0045b8b8
spent
true